
Magic mushrooms, also known as psilocybin mushrooms, are a group of fungi that contain the psychoactive compound psilocybin. They have been used for centuries in various cultures for their hallucinogenic properties and are often associated with spiritual and mystical experiences. In recent years, there has been a growing interest in the potential therapeutic benefits of psilocybin, leading to increased research and legalization in some regions for medicinal use. However, in many places, magic mushrooms remain illegal and are sold on the black market. The street price of magic mushrooms can vary significantly depending on factors such as location, quality, and availability.

Average street price per gram/ounce
The average street price per gram or ounce of magic mushrooms can vary significantly depending on several factors, including the region, the quality of the mushrooms, and the current market conditions. As of the latest data available up to June 2024, the price can range from $10 to $50 per gram in different parts of the world. In the United States, for instance, the average price is often around $20 to $30 per gram, while in Europe, it can be slightly higher, ranging from €25 to €40 per gram.
One of the key factors influencing the street price of magic mushrooms is the quality and potency of the product. Higher-quality mushrooms, which are fresher and have a higher concentration of psilocybin, the active compound, tend to command a higher price. Additionally, the price can fluctuate based on supply and demand dynamics. During periods of high demand or low supply, prices may spike, and conversely, during times of abundant supply or reduced demand, prices may drop.
It's also important to note that the legality of magic mushrooms varies by country and even by state or region within a country. In places where they are illegal, the price may be higher due to the risks associated with smuggling and distribution. In contrast, in areas where they are legal or decriminalized, the price may be lower due to the reduced risk and increased availability.
When considering the average street price per gram or ounce, it's crucial to be aware of the potential risks and legal implications associated with purchasing and using magic mushrooms. In many places, they are still considered a controlled substance, and possession or use can result in legal consequences. Furthermore, the quality and safety of street-bought mushrooms can be questionable, as they may be contaminated or mislabeled.
In conclusion, the average street price per gram or ounce of magic mushrooms is influenced by a variety of factors, including regional differences, product quality, market conditions, and legal status. As such, it's essential to approach the topic with caution and to be well-informed about the potential risks and legal implications involved.

Factors influencing cost (quality, location, season)
The cost of magic mushrooms on the street can vary significantly based on several factors. One of the primary influences is the quality of the mushrooms. High-quality mushrooms, which are fresh, potent, and free from contaminants, tend to command a higher price. Conversely, lower quality mushrooms that may be older, less potent, or contaminated can be cheaper. It's important to note that the potency of magic mushrooms can vary widely, and this can greatly affect the user's experience.
Location is another crucial factor affecting the cost. In areas where magic mushrooms are more readily available and the demand is high, prices may be lower due to the abundance of supply. However, in regions where they are harder to come by or where the risk of legal consequences is greater, prices can be significantly higher. Urban areas tend to have higher prices compared to rural areas due to the higher cost of living and the greater risk of law enforcement.
Seasonality also plays a role in the pricing of magic mushrooms. During certain times of the year, particularly in the fall, mushrooms may be more abundant due to favorable growing conditions. This increased supply can lead to lower prices. On the other hand, during times when mushrooms are less available, such as in the winter or during droughts, prices can rise due to the scarcity.
It's also worth considering the risks associated with purchasing magic mushrooms on the street. Not only can the quality vary, but there is also the risk of legal consequences, as well as the potential for purchasing mushrooms that have been laced with other substances. These risks can contribute to the overall cost, as buyers may need to take additional precautions or pay a premium for mushrooms from a trusted source.
In conclusion, the cost of magic mushrooms on the street is influenced by a variety of factors, including quality, location, and season. Understanding these factors can help buyers make informed decisions and potentially find better deals. However, it's important to remember that purchasing magic mushrooms on the street carries inherent risks, and buyers should always prioritize their safety and well-being.

Potential health risks and safety concerns
Magic mushrooms, also known as psilocybin mushrooms, carry several potential health risks and safety concerns, particularly when purchased on the street. One of the primary risks is the possibility of ingesting a toxic or poisonous mushroom species, which can result in severe gastrointestinal symptoms, organ failure, or even death. Street vendors may not always be knowledgeable about the specific types of mushrooms they are selling, increasing the likelihood of accidental poisoning.
Another significant concern is the variability in the potency of street-bought magic mushrooms. Psilocybin content can vary widely depending on the species, growing conditions, and preparation methods. This unpredictability can lead to users inadvertently consuming a much higher dose than intended, potentially resulting in intense and overwhelming psychedelic experiences, anxiety, or panic attacks.
Furthermore, magic mushrooms can interact with certain medications, such as antidepressants, which may exacerbate underlying mental health conditions or lead to dangerous drug interactions. Users with pre-existing mental health issues, such as schizophrenia or bipolar disorder, may also be at a higher risk of experiencing adverse psychological effects.
In addition to these health risks, there are legal and safety concerns associated with purchasing magic mushrooms on the street. In many jurisdictions, psilocybin mushrooms are illegal, and possession or distribution can result in criminal charges. Street purchases also carry the risk of being sold counterfeit or adulterated products, which may contain harmful substances or fail to produce the desired effects.
